WHAT YOU’LL DO

As a Senior People Business Partner, you will play a key role in aligning people strategies with NKF objectives, providing support and guidance to employees and senior leadership in your assigned (internal) client group. You will operate skillfully as both a strategic thinker and operational executor.

  • Collaborate with senior leadership to understand business goals and develop strategies to support them.
  • Contribute to the development and execution of initiatives that enhance organizational effectiveness.
  • Act as a trusted advisor to employees and leadership on People-related issues.
  • Leverage data to use as insights in making people-related decisions.
  • Partner with leaders to assess the optimal organizational design to optimize performance.
  • Facilitate change management strategies and practices to ensure the successful implementation of organizational initiatives.
  • Mediate and resolve workplace conflicts, ensuring a positive and inclusive work environment.
  • Partner with hiring managers to establish workforce planning needs and strategies.
  • Implement talent development programs to nurture employee growth and succession planning.
  • Employ coaching strategies for leaders and staff.
  • Provide guidance on performance management processes, including goal setting, performance reviews, and employee development plans.
  • Design and deploy total rewards strategies that attract and retain top talent.
  • Develop and implement initiatives to support and enhance DEI initiatives, employee engagement, belonging, and retention.
  • Stay informed about changes in employment laws and regulations, ensuring company compliance.


WHAT YOU’LL POSSESS

  • Bachelor's degree in Human Resources, Business Administration, or a related field. Master's degree or SHRM certification will be a plus.
  • Seven to ten years of proven experience as a People Business Partner or similar role; experience across most, if not all, people practice areas.
  • Strong understanding of People practices, employment laws, and regulations.
  • Excellent communication and interpersonal skills.
  • Ability to build strong relationships with employees at all levels.
  • Ability to critically assess challenges and identify creative, effective solutions.
  • Strategic thinking and problem-solving skills.
  • Proficient in related technical applications and Microsoft Office Suite.
